AWAKINO DOG TRIALS.
NEXT WEEK’S fIXTURE. Arrangements are well in hand for Awakino’s event of the year, viz., the Collie Club’s sixteenth dog trial meeting, which will be held on Mr,.’W. D. Thomson’s grounds next Thursday and Friday, 9th and 10th insts. Entries closed on Thursday, and given fine weather some keen competitions should be witnessed. The tea kiosk will be under the capable supervision of Mrs. Galvin. A grand concert ha* been arranged for the Thursday night, when a feast is in store for lovers of music. The following night will witness the Collie Club’s annual ball, at which the trophies won at the trials will be presented.
